Targeted 2‐Deoxy‐D‐Ribose Delivery by Biomimetic Nanoplatform Activates EGFR for Accelerated Heart Valve Endothelialization

open access: yesAdvanced Science, EarlyView.
This study develops a biomimetic nanoplatform using erythrocyte membrane‐camouflaged, CD144 antibody‐functionalized nanoparticles to deliver 2‐deoxy‐D‐ribose (2dDR). This system promotes heart valve endothelialization by enhancing endothelial cell migration and proliferation via EGFR activation, while improving hemocompatibility.
